Mullite sintering machine grate bar and preparation method thereof
The invention discloses a mullite sintering machine grate bar and a preparation method thereof, and belongs to the technical field of refractory materials. The mullite sintering machine grate bar is prepared from the following raw materials in percentage by mass: 85 to 90 percent of mullite, 2 to 8 percent of industrial aluminum oxide, 2 to 8 percent of clay powder, 1 to 3 percent of organic binding agent, 0.1 to 0.5 percent of dispersing agent and 5 to 10 percent of additional water. According to the sintering machine grate bar prepared by the invention, the mullite phase content is more than 90%, the apparent porosity is less than 19%, the volume density is more than 2.5 g/cm < 3 >, the refractoriness under load is more than 1650 DEG C, and the compression strength at normal temperature is more than 100 MPa. The sintering machine grate bar made of the mullite material is developed, the mullite material is used for replacing a metal material, the advantages of abrasion resistance, high strength, high temperature resistance, good thermal shock resistance and non-oxidation of the mullite material are exerted, the sintering machine grate bar can better adapt to the working condition of a sintering machine compared with a metal grate bar, and the service life of the grate bar can be prolonged to 9-18 months.
